From a highbrow standpoint, public data upon Instagram is, by definition, public. If an account is set to "Public," anyone gone an internet connection can view its grid posts and Reels by straightforwardly visiting the profile via a web browser.
Third-party viewer sites capitalize upon this by acting as a scraping bridge. They use automated scripts (bots) to tug publicly handy data from Instagram’s servers and display it upon their own independent web interfaces.
Because you aren't logging into your personal Instagram account to view the content, your username doesn’t appear in the creator's "Seen By" list.
Crucial Caveat: Authenticated third-party listeners cannot bypass privacy settings. If a addict’s account is set to Private, uncovered viewer websites cannot entrance their content. If a third-party site claims it can undertaking you private profiles, it is all but agreed a scam or a phishing try designed to steal your credentials or data.
